Gait pattern generation under disturbance force

2016 16th International Conference on Control, Automation and Systems (ICCAS), 2016
This paper describes a gait pattern generation and the mechanisms of a biped humanoid robot that has 42 DOFs in total. The movable angles of the joints of the biped robot are about the same as those of a human. Its height is 1.66 [m] and its weight is 62.5 [kg].

Disturbance attenuation for general nonlinear systems

Proceedings of 1994 33rd IEEE Conference on Decision and Control, 2002
This paper presents some solutions to the problem of disturbance attenuation via state feedback and measurement feedback for general nonlinear systems, respectively. The results given in this paper generalize those for affine nonlinear systems. >
